La Boquilla

We are thinking of spending a few nights here after a week at a resort on Boca Grande. Is this a fun area? Are there any small botique type hotels you recommend? We would like to spend between $100--200 a night. Thanks!

La Boquilla... not really all that fun for a longer stay. Right up against a slum. Not sure the beach is even clean enough for swimming. It can be interesting to go there for an afternoon, drink beer and listen to vallenato.

You could maybe stay out on Tierrabomba... there are some all inclusives out there where you could easily spend $200 per night. This is one of the more economical options, the only one I've personally stayed at:

Boquilla is just north of the CTG airport. About 15,000 COP from Boca Grande will be the cost by taxi, so no reason to leave your Boca Grande hotel, since Boquilla is basically just a beach, unless you want a quiet scene at night.
